Chris Watts is a scholar working on General Health Professions, Statistics, Probability and Uncertainty and Sociology and Political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Chris Watts has authored 3 papers receiving a total of 229 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 3 papers in General Health Professions, 3 papers in Statistics, Probability and Uncertainty and 1 paper in Sociology and Political Science. Recurrent topics in Chris Watts’s work include Meta-analysis and systematic reviews (3 papers), Patient and Public Engagement in Healthcare Research (3 papers) and Health Policy Implementation Science (2 papers). Chris Watts is often cited by papers focused on Meta-analysis and systematic reviews (3 papers), Patient and Public Engagement in Healthcare Research (3 papers) and Health Policy Implementation Science (2 papers). Chris Watts coll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om and Australia. Chris Watts's co-authors include Alex Pollock, Anneliese Synnot, Richard Morley, Caroline Struthers, Heather Goodare, Sophie Hill, Pauline Campbell, Jack Nunn and Jacqui Morris and has published in prestigious journals such as Systematic Reviews, Journal of Health Services Research & Policy and Research Involvement and Engagement.
